Vince McMahon is once again in the headlines, after getting a search warrant from federal agents. The Executive Chairman of WWE has also been provided with a subpoena that will drive him into the judicial investigation in the coming months. McMahon received the search warrant just a day after Donald Trump was also charged by a federal grand jury in Washington, D.C. It was related to his loss in the 2020 presidential election.
Vince McMahon and the former US President are longtime friends. Trump made an appearance at WrestleMania 23 and he was also inducted into the Hall of Fame in 2013.
